Michael Wilson (cyclist)

Australian cyclist From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Michael Wilson (born 15 January 1960) is a former Australian racing cyclist. He rode in nine Grand Tours between 1982 and 1989.[1][2] He also rode in two events at the 1980 Summer Olympics.[3]

Wilson set the fastest time in the amateur Goulburn to Sydney Classic in 1978 run from Goulburn to Liverpool.[4]
